How are notices, approvals, agreements, or other communications required or permitted to be given under the Atwell Suites Agreement?
Atwell_Suites Franchise · 2025 FDDAnswer from 2025 FDD Document
In any case where any notice, approval, agreement or other communication is required or permitted to be given under this Agreement, such notice, approval, agreement or communication shall be in writing and deemed to have been duly given and delivered (a) if delivered in person, on the date of such delivery; or (b) if sent by overnight express or registered or certified mail (with return receipt requested), on the date of receipt of such mail.
Such notice or other communication shall be sent to (i) with respect to HotelKey, at the address set forth in the preamble, (ii) with respect to Hotel, the address(es) set forth in the Hotel Agreement, and (iii) with respect to IHG, at the address set forth in Section 11.9 (IHG Contracting Entity; Governing Law) below.
A Party may update its notice address from time to time by notifying the other Parties in writing in accordance with this section.

What This Means (2025 FDD)
According to the 2025 Atwell Suites FDD, any required or permitted notice, approval, agreement, or other communication must be in writing. It is considered duly given and delivered either on the date of personal delivery or on the date of receipt if sent by overnight express, registered, or certified mail with a return receipt requested.
The notice or communication should be sent to HotelKey at the address in the preamble of the agreement, to the Hotel at the addresses in the Hotel Agreement, and to IHG at the address in Section 11.9 of the agreement. Any party can update their notice address by notifying the other parties in writing as per this section.
For Atwell Suites franchisees, this means that all official communications with the franchisor must be documented in writing and sent via specific methods to ensure proof of delivery. It is important to keep records of all such communications, including dates and delivery confirmations, as they may be critical for legal or contractual purposes. Franchisees should also promptly update their address with the franchisor if it changes to ensure they receive all important notices.
